#af01ed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#af01ed is composed of 68.6% red, 0.4%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.2% cyan, 99.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 284.2 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 46.7%. #af01ed color hex could be obtained by blending #ff02ff with #5f00db. Closest websafe color is: #9900ff.

Shades and Tints of #af01ed

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020003 is the darkest color, while #fbee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#af01ed

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b6f7f is the less saturated color, while #af01ed is the most saturated one.
